Core concepts

Concept 1

Clarify mission, objectives, stakeholder interests and the organisation's current value proposition.

Exam cue: Identify the requirement, stakeholders, evidence and current ICAEW principle relevant to strategic analysis.

Concept 2

Analyse external forces, industry structure, markets, competitors and technology developments using scenario evidence.

Exam cue: Structure the analysis or calculation, challenge the data and connect each conclusion to the supplied scenario.

Concept 3

Evaluate resources, capabilities, culture, governance, data and organisational design for strengths and constraints.

Exam cue: Check ethics, professional scepticism, sustainability, communication and practical implementation before finalising.
